The greatest safety item in the whole shop rests between your ears. If you're suicidal, all the gloves, aprons, face shields and boots in the world won't save you.

I think I read a statistic one time that said 9 out of 10 "accidents" were foreseen by the injured craftsman, and that they occurred because he continued to do the dangerous task, thinking "it should be fine".

Then again, good judgment is usually only gained through experience, which almost always comes with it's fair share of small injuries resulting from the experience you have yet to acquire.

(safety gear: half mask respirator and clear plastic full face shield for grinding, gloves for forging though not essential, 2 or 3 strong fans to keep air circulating in the garage/shop with all doors open, jeans are the norm for most days.)
